In our three year history, Diva Dirt has largely refrained from having a strict commenting policy but as of today that changes. Frankly, there has been a great deal of abuse to our commenting system by users in recent memory and it’s not pleasant for visitors, or us.

The comments section is supposed to be a community for civilized discussion and debate. It is in our best interest to ensure that the comments section is friendly and welcoming, so effective today, we are implementing the following policy. If you choose to create a Diva Dirt user account and comment on an article, we ask that you adhere to this policy.

Additionally, we are installing a few comment moderators who will regularly check the comments section and remove anything that isn’t in compliance with our new policy.
